Mentored Research Programs

Faculty and staff can play a key role as mentors by providing opportunities for students to practice their research skills in a real-world setting.  Undergraduate research can take place in a variety of venues such as the classroom, faculty labs, institutes, centers, campus offices, and in the community.  Beginning February 2009, mentors will be able to post research opportunities via eDiscovery for all students to search and access.

Once a student has completed a mentored research experience, the faculty mentor should complete the Mentored Undergraduate Research Assessment to evaluate their student's work product.
